nostr-auth-agents
Nostr sign-in for LLM coding agents — auth-only, no wallet, no browser extension, no relay account.
An agent (Claude Code, OpenCode, OpenClaw, Codex, Cursor, ...) is handed a "Sign in with Nostr" challenge or event template. This repo signs it with a secp256k1 (BIP-340 schnorr) key derived from a local master secret, and optionally submits the signature to the service callback.
Zero npm runtime dependencies: pure BigInt secp256k1/schnorr + node:crypto.
Boots from a clean clone.

Key management
First run generates a 32-byte master secret at
~/.config/nostr-auth/master.key(mode0600).Per-service identity:
linkingPriv = HMAC-SHA256(master, serviceDomain). Same domain → same npub; different domains → different npubs (privacy).--single-keyshares one identity across all services.--generateoverwrites the master secret. Override path with--keyfile/--keyoutor theNOSTR_AUTH_KEYFILEenv var.
Protocol (NIP-07 style)
Challenge → event (kind
22242by default) withchallengeand optionalrelaytags.NIP-01 id:
sha256(JSON.stringify([0, pubkey, created_at, kind, tags, content])).BIP-340 schnorr sign the raw 32-byte id → 64-byte hex
sig.POST
{"event": {...}}to the callback →{"status":"OK"}/{"status":"ERROR","reason":"..."}.

Self-test (offline, cost-free)
npm ci
npm testA local mock "Sign in with Nostr" service (mock_server.js) validates the
challenge → sign → submit → verify roundtrip, replay rejection, dry-run
safety, per-domain identity stability, and the portable skill bundle.
